Today we’d like to introduce you to Skylar Lewis.
Skylar, we appreciate you taking the time to share your story with us today. Where does your story begin?
I started my business two years ago when I was five. I started selling lemonade and rice krispy treats in my neighborhood. Skylar’s Sweet Snacks really grew in 2020 when I put my lemonade in bottles and my treats in bags so we can have less contact with my customers because of COVID. I had a great summer selling lemonade and I even won a contest for Best Business lemonade stand and won a bike. My mommy signed me up and I sell my products at the local farmers market. I wanted to show other kids how much fun and inspire them to have their own business so I wrote a coloring and activity book about selling lemonade Skylar’s Sweet Idea you get it on Amazon. My dream is for my lemonade to be sold in stores one day.
